The Ripple Effects of the Fox News-Dominion Settlement on Media Integrity

Examining the implications of the recent defamation settlement on journalistic standards and public trust.

In April 2023, a pivotal moment in the realm of media accountability unfolded when a judge announced that "the parties have resolved their case" in the historic defamation trial between Fox News and Dominion Voting Systems. The settlement, which has drawn significant attention, not only marks a resolution for the parties involved but also poses crucial questions for the broader landscape of journalism and the role of media in democracy.

The Nature of the Settlement

Details surrounding the terms of the settlement remain undisclosed, but the implications resonate far beyond the courtroom. The case centered on accusations that Fox News disseminated false claims regarding the integrity of the 2020 presidential election, claims that Dominion argued were defamatory and damaging to its reputation. The resolution of this trial underscores the ongoing debate over the responsibilities of news organizations to report truthfully and the potential consequences when they stray from that path.

Media Responsibility and Public Trust

The Fox News-Dominion settlement arrives at a time when trust in media is critically low. Many Americans express skepticism regarding the accuracy and impartiality of news sources, a sentiment that has only worsened in recent years. The resolution of this case provides an opportunity for reflection on the ethical obligations of media outlets to uphold journalistic integrity. If news organizations are perceived as prioritizing sensationalism over truth, public trust erodes, ultimately undermining democracy itself.

Moreover, the settlement raises important questions about the accountability of powerful media entities. While smaller outlets often face stringent consequences for lapses in accuracy, larger organizations sometimes escape similar scrutiny. This discrepancy can lead to a dangerous precedent where misinformation can flourish without sufficient checks. The discourse surrounding this settlement highlights the need for a commitment to transparency and accountability within mainstream media.
